French 2100, Course Description.
Newfoundland and Labrador Dept. of Education, St. John's. Div. of Instruction.
The objectives and course description of a one-credit high school French course intended for the first year of Newfoundland senior high schools are presented. Its major objectives relate to development of language skills in four areas (listening, speaking, reading, and writing), attitudinal development, and cultural understanding. The major grammatical points include aspects of the past perfect, relative pronouns, the pronoun "en," and the verb "prendre" as they complement development of the four skill areas. Geographical and cultural information about a region of Quebec is presented in a reader, supplemented by teacher-selected materials and content. Some materials are suggested. The philosophy of instruction in Newfoundland and Labrador French programs is outlined, and recommended instructional methodology, texts, and student evaluation techniques for each skill area and the affective objective are included.
